AI Chatbot for Prostate Radiation Therapy Patient Education
Clinical Evaluation of Large Language Model (LLM) Methods to Support Prostate Cancer Radiation Therapy Patient Education
This study will evaluate whether an artificial intelligence chatbot can help patients better understand radiation therapy for localized prostate cancer. Participants will be adults with prostate cancer who are planning definitive radiation therapy at Brigham and Women's Hospital.
All participants will receive standard radiation therapy education and clinician-led discussions as part of routine care. In addition, participants will interact with an educational chatbot about prostate cancer radiation therapy. The chatbot is designed to provide plain-language information about treatment logistics, preparation, possible side effects, follow-up, and when to contact the care team. The chatbot will not provide diagnosis, treatment recommendations, individualized medical advice, or replace conversations with clinicians.
Participants will complete questionnaires before and after using the chatbot. The study will measure changes in patient understanding, confidence in managing symptoms, usability of the chatbot, and safety-related concerns identified during clinician review of chatbot responses.

Inclusion Criteria:
- Age 18 years or older
- Current diagnosis of prostate cancer
- Planning to receive definitive prostate cancer radiation therapy at Brigham and Women's Hospital Department of Radiation Oncology
- English-speaking
- Ability to understand and willingness to provide informed consent
Exclusion Criteria:
- Adults unable to consent independently
- Individuals who are not yet adults
- Prisoners

Participants will interact with an LLM-based educational chatbot focused on prostate cancer radiation therapy. The chatbot provides plain-language information about treatment logistics, preparation, expected follow-up, possible urinary, bowel, sexual, and hormonal side effects, symptom monitoring, and when to contact the care team. The chatbot is used as an adjunct to standard radiation therapy education and clinician-led discussions. The chatbot is based on ChatGPT 5.2 deployed within a secure Mass General Brigham Azure environment and configured with physician-reviewed educational source materials and safety guardrails. It is designed to provide educational information only and does not diagnose, recommend treatment choices, provide individualized medical advice, or alter clinical management. Participant interactions will not be used to train, fine-tune, or update the underlying foundation model. |
